UBC JOURNAL OF POLITICAL STUDIES

The UBC Journal of Political Studies (JPS) is one of the longest-running and most highly regarded undergraduate research journals in the country. The JPS is published by the UBC Political Science Student Association in partnership with the UBC Department of Political Science, and we have been in print for the past 20 years.

The best undergraduate political science papers by current and former UBC students are published, spanning a wide variety of subfields which include Canadian and US politics, international relations, political theory and comparative politics. Papers are selected on the basis of originality of research, conceptual innovation, topicality of subject matter, and overall quality of writing.

PAPER SPECIFICATIONS

Each student can submit up to two papers that are no more than 5,000 words each. 

To be competitive, papers should have received grades of 80% or higher in an undergraduate course (2nd year and above; first-year papers will not be considered).

The paper must be in doc format. Additionally, it must have a title, the author's name, and the course name for which the paper was written.
